Understanding Local Climate Considerations
Erie’s climate ranges from cold, snowy winters to sunny, dry summers. To handle these extremes, choose materials that withstand both moisture and temperature changes. Porcelain floor tiles and quartz or solid-surface countertops are reliable selections—offering water resistance, durability, and easy upkeep. Proper insulation and heated flooring can boost year-round comfort, while a robust ventilation system guards against mold and keeps indoor air fresh. Taking these elements into account from the start ensures your remodeled bathroom is both beautiful and built for Colorado living.
Maximizing Space and Layout
For many Erie homes, the primary bathroom isn’t expansive. Clever design is the key to making the most of every square foot. Consider an open-concept plan paired with floating vanities or wall-mounted fixtures, which give the illusion of a larger, more open space. Walk-in showers with seamless, frameless glass doors increase light flow and foster an uncluttered, modern look. Custom cabinetry and integrated shelving provide efficient storage without crowding the room.

Budgeting and Planning
Smart planning keeps your remodel on track and within budget. Start by outlining your must-haves and prioritizing upgrades that deliver everyday value or long-term efficiency. Pricing for materials and labor can differ widely in Erie, so gather several quotes and ask about the scope of included services. Be sure to build in a contingency budget for surprises, such as plumbing updates or hidden structural issues. Financing options and timelines should also be clarified before construction begins to make your remodel as smooth as possible.

Enhancing Storage Solutions
Even luxurious bathrooms can lose their appeal if cluttered. Smart storage solutions, like built-in shelves, recessed medicine cabinets, and deep vanity drawers, keep toiletries organized and surfaces clear. Today’s custom cabinetry is designed for both beautiful display and practical function, allowing you to stow away towels, grooming items, and more without sacrificing style. Thoughtful storage enhances the usability and serenity of your new bathroom, whether you’re dealing with a compact footprint or a spacious suite.
Lighting and Ventilation
Lighting transforms the feel of any bathroom. A layered approach, combining bright, even task lighting with softer ambient and accent options, makes every part of the room work for you, from shaving to unwinding in the tub. Natural light, via skylights or well-placed windows, also makes a significant impact. Equally, never overlook ventilation. Properly installed fans and air circulation systems prevent humidity buildup, which is especially important in Erie's rapidly changing weather patterns, promoting a healthy, comfortable environment for years to come.
